University of oxford, department of computer science wolfson building, parks road, oxford ox1 3qd, uk. Write your content with the natural language generation tool from ax semantics. Processing of natural language is required when you want an intelligent system like robot to perform as per your instructions, when you want to hear decision. Cl 4 feb 2015 open system categorical quantum semantics in natural language processing robin piedeleu. Once the nlpnlu application using this model starts to operate the user sentences that. Naturallanguage processing has its roots in semiotics, the study of signs. Jul 02, 2018 as mentioned above, natural language processing is a form of artificial intelligence that analyzes the human language. The work of semantic analyzer is to check the text f.
The natlog project aims to develop an approach to natural language inference based on a model of natural logic, which identifies valid inferences by their lexical and syntactic features, without full semantic interpretation. It takes many forms, but at its core, the technology helps machine understand. The applied computer systems processing natural language printed or written texts nltexts or oral speech with respect to the fact that the words are associated with some meanings are called semantics oriented natural language processing s tems nlpss. Natural language processing nlp is a subfield of linguistics, computer science, information engineering, and artificial intelligence concerned with the interactions between computers and human natural languages, in particular how to program computers to process and analyze large amounts of natural language data. Natural language processing is revolutionizing the way humans interact with tech. Keywords quantum computing, natural language processing, sentence similarity 1 classification, wordphrase similarity, test classification and introduction natural language processing nlp is often used to perform tasks. Natural language processing commonly abbreviated nlp is a type of machine learning specialized for analyzing human languages. We provide statistical nlp, deep learning nlp, and rulebased nlp tools for major computational linguistics problems, which can be incorporated into applications with human language technology needs.
Because semantic analysis and natural language processing can help machines automatically understand text, this supports the even larger goal of translating informationthat potentially valuable piece of customer feedback or insight in a tweet or in a customer service loginto the realm of business intelligence for customer support. Keywords quantum computing, natural language processing, sentence similarity 1 classification, wordphrase similarity, test classification and introduction natural language processing nlp is. Open system categorical quantum semantics in natural language. Once the nlpnlu application using this model starts to operate the user sentences that cannot be automatically understood by the this model. Grants experience includes engineering a variety of search, question answering and natural language processing applications for a variety of. Grant ingersoll grant is the cto and cofounder of lucidworks, coauthor of taming text from manning publications, cofounder of apache mahout and a longstanding committer on the apache lucene and solr open source projects. Unlike more conventional forms of machine learning, nlp utilizes advanced forms of unsupervised learning to effectively read or listen in a way similar to humans. Wikipediabased semantic interpretation for natural language.
The tools of formal semantics are similar to nlunlp tools but the aim is to understand how people construct meaning more than any specific application. I am predicting the phasing out of the kind of nlp weve been doing so far in the next 25 ye. What is natural language processing nlp and how is it used. How natural language processing will change the semantic web. Semantic modelling or semantic grammar is often compared to linguistic. In particular, it reports on work and networks in the realm of schema. Nlp research at columbia nlp at columbia university. Inspired by the success of word embeddingtechniques in several nlp tasks, we. Natural language processing has its roots in semiotics, the study of signs. Natural language processing word morphology linguistics.
My background covers software engineering for data science, including the whole application lifecycle management, with emphasis on semantics, textual data and natural language processing. How to mix semantics, artificial intelligence and language. Parsing natural language processing natural language processing is a collection. Sep 11, 2019 my background covers software engineering for data science, including the whole application lifecycle management, with emphasis on semantics, textual data and natural language processing. The aim of this series is to stimulate publication of. Natural language processing semantic analysis tutorialspoint. In recent years, we have elaborated a framework to be used in packages dealing with the processing. Oct 15, 2018 natural language processing, usually shortened as nlp, is a branch of artificial intelligence that deals with the interaction between computers and humans using the natural language. A simple introduction to natural language processing. Semantics in broadcoverage natural language processing. Semantic analysis of natural language processing in a. Natural language processing nlp and semantic web technologies are both. Open system categorical quantum semantics in natural.
Semantics of natural language synthese library 2nd edition. Suggest as a translation of natural language processing software. Natural language processing aka nlp is a field of computer science, artificial intelligence focused on the ability of the machines to comprehend language and interpret messages. With its broad applications and convenient technology, nlp is proving to be a valuable addition to businesses, schools, and health organizations.
Natural language toolkit nltk it would be easy to argue that natural language toolkit nltk is the most fullfeatured tool of the ones i surveyed. Natural language processing nlp is a subfield of linguistics, computer science, information. Introduction to linguistics for natural language processing ted briscoe computer laboratory university of cambridge c ted briscoe, michaelmas term 20 october 8, 20 abstract this handout is a guide to the linguistic theory and techniques of analysis that will be useful for the acs language and speech modules. No matter your industry, nlp software s machine learning enables the software to parse lengthy texts and databases, identify emotions and trends, and apply those concepts to your companybe it customer service, research, or marketing. Top natural language processing nlp software with syntactic. When you really want to understand meaning in text. Share parts of your configuration between projects through copy and paste. Natural language processing nlp represents linguistic power and computer science combined into a revolutionary ai tool. Ticary solutions is a natural language processing nlp and machine learning ml consulting company with expertise in a wide variety of nlp problems including corpus creation, sentiment analysis, topic modeling, keyword extraction, information retrieval and search, information extraction, question answering and chatbots. Natural language processing with python by steven bird, ewan klein, and edward loper is the definitive guide for nltk, walking users through tasks like classification, information extraction and more. Introduction into semantic modeling for natural language processing.
As mentioned above, natural language processing is a form of artificial intelligence that analyzes the human language. While not directly related to natural language processing in the software sense, its fundamental structure can help software engineers and scientists engineer nlp more effectively. The work of semantic analyzer is to check the text for meaningfulness. Software the stanford natural language processing group. Reduce your time to content and costs for text production.
Natural language processing has come a long way since the 50s when scientists were first testing out the implications of artificial intelligence and a machines ability to understand language. Fomichov ifsr was established to stimulate all activities associated with the scienti. Chapter 17 then introduces techniques for semantic parsing. This application of nlp technology is often used in conjunction with search, but. Introduction to linguistics for natural language processing. Traditionally, stanford has used natural logic for textual entailment. Alchemyapi service provider of a natural language processing api. Natural language processing research at columbia university is conducted in the computer science department, the center for computational learning systems and the biomedical informatics department. Wikipediabased semantic interpretation for natural.
The language processing hierarchy, developed by educator gail richards in 2011, is a holistic model of language processing in early childhood education. Poolparty software suite helps enterprises process and analyze large amounts of natural language data, by turning natural language into useful data. Volume 27 semanticsoriented natural language processing. As ceo of the ontos gmbh and a media informatics scientist with a phd in the interface between web engineering, semantic web and information visualization, martin voigt knows how painstaking the study of entire documents is. Natural language processing, the framework that such devices are built on, is responsible for a range of new innovations, including highly capable chatbots. Online forums are highly popular among web users due to the possibility they offer them of obtaining relevant answers to the questions they raise. Use markdown for text formatting and add headlines, boldings. The tool natural language generation software by ax semantics. Natural language processing, usually shortened as nlp, is a branch of artificial intelligence that deals with the interaction between computers and humans using the natural language. Ticary solutions a natural language processing consultancy. Semantics in broadcoverage natural language processing ann copestake computer laboratory university of cambridge october 2006 ann copestake semantics in broadcoverage natural language processing.
Apr, 2016 as a headup to the semantics 2016 we invited several experts from the joint project linked enterprise data service leds to talk a bit about their work and visions. Social media, blog posts, comments in forums, documents, group chat. Semiotics was developed by charles sanders peirce a logician and philosopher and. Nlp is what we used to do, because we didnt know how to get to semantics. On the natural language processing side, that has allowed systems to far more rapidly analyze large amounts of text data.
Natural language processing nlp and semantic web technologies are both semantic technologies, but with different and complementary roles in data management. What is the relation of natural language semantics to. Learning meaning in natural language processing the. They will share their insights into the fields of natural language processing, ecommerce, egovernment, data integration and quality assurance right here. Many translated example sentences containing natural language processing software frenchenglish dictionary and search engine for french translations. Calais reuters product provider of a natural language processing services. Semantria offers multilayered sentiment analysis, categorization, entity recognition, theme analysis, intention detection and summarization in an easytointegrate restful api package. This entails breaking down both the syntax and the semantics of the. It implements pretty much any component of nlp you would need, like classification, tokenization, stemming, tagging, parsing, and semantic reasoning.
This volume is a classic in the areas of descriptive linguistics, semantics, philosophy of logic and philosophy of language. It implements pretty much any component of nlp you would need, like classification, tokenization, stemming. Semantria is a natural language processing nlp api from lexalytics, leaders in enterprise sentiment analysis and text analytics since 2004. We can define nlp as a set of algorithms designed to explore, recognize, and utilize textbased information and identify insights for the benefit of the business. Introduction into semantic modelling for natural language processing. Speech and language processing, pearson prentice hall. Ax semantics software is intuitive and quickly able to generate all the content needed to keep pace with your business needs. So natural language nl includes, in particular, the english, russian, and german languages. A field of science systematic enterprise that builds and organizes knowledge in the form of testable explanations and predictions about the universe an applied science field that applies human knowledge to build or design useful things a field of computer science. The natural language toolkit also features an introduction into programming and detailed documentation, making it suitable for students, faculty, and researchers. Languagerelated linked open data for knowledge solutions, artificial intelligence and more this presentation sketches exploratory work on languagerelated linked data. Natural language processing semantic analysis the purpose of semantic analysis is to draw exact meaning, or you can say dictionary meaning from the text.
Ax software is 100% saas everything is available from your desk via your web browser, no programming or it departments required. Andreas is ceo and cofounder of the semantic web company. It allows for simultaneous semantic representation of more than one language feature that. Natural language processing can be described as all of the following. What is natural language processing nlp and how is it. Test changes and correct errors easily with undo and redo. The conference looks for significant contributions to all major fields of the natural language. Naturallanguage processing nlp is an area of computer science and artificial intelligence concerned with the interactions between computers and human natural languages, in particular how to program computers to fruitfully process large amounts of natural language data.
Natural language processing nlp is one area of artificial intelligence using computational linguistics that provides parsing and semantic interpretation of text, which allows systems to learn, analyze, and understand human language. Natural language processing semantic analysis the purpose of semantic. Ticary solutions is a natural language processing consultancy that provides fullstack software solutions. Ax semantics provides nlg capabilities in over 100 languages, the report explains. Natural language processing poolparty semantic suite. Natural language processing nlp is the ability of a computer program to understand human language as it is spoken. The purpose of semantic analysis is to draw exact meaning, or you can say dictionary meaning from the text. An explicit formalization of natural language semantics without confusions with implicit assumptions such as closedworld assumption cwa vs.
If you are a developer looking to get started with natural language processing, then you must be wondering about the books you should read and whether there are good online courses for nlp. In fact, the merging of nlp and semantic web technologies enables people to combine structured and unstructured data in ways that are not viable using traditional tools. Automatic analysis of human language by computer algorithms. Ax semantics is best for companies that need nlg for analytics on a budget. The ultimate objective of nlp is to read, decipher, understand, and make sense of the human languages in a manner that is valuable. The applied computer systems processing natural language printed or written texts nltexts or oral speech with respect to the fact that the words are associated with some meanings are called semanticsoriented natural language processing s tems nlpss. This is the most important and complex step in the process, in which the ai software applies a set of natural language processing algorithms to the data it has received and converts it into language that the computer can both understand and process. The stanford nlp group makes some of our natural language processing software available to everyone. How natural language processing will change the semantic. This is one of the challenges of semantics in relation to automatic natural language processing. Natural language processing nlp refers to ai method of communicating with an intelligent systems using a natural language such as english.
The language industries are also developing software programs that are language processing tools designed to enable computers. Semantic analysis of natural language processing in a study. Finally, we discuss how iterated application of the cpmconstruction, which gives rise to states that have no interpretation in quantum theory, does have a natural application in natural language processing. Build apps with natural language processing nlp ibm. But ax semantics also uses ai and machine learning to train the platforms nlp engine. As a headup to the semantics 2016 we invited several experts from the joint project linked enterprise data service leds to talk a bit about their work and visions.
540 1135 549 682 421 778 1292 574 1314 1151 614 1468 929 906 1178 1184 885 647 634 1174 636 336 241 1108 1252 90 643 427 1314 1423 818 1126 174 1454 693 18 502 1170 952 1065 1083 1192 1251 245 114 1227 52